The Influence Of Remifentanil Preconditioning On The Oxidative Damage By Renal Ischemia Reperfusion In Rats

Objective To observe the influence of remifentanil preconditioning on the oxidative damage by renal ischemia reperfusion in rats.Assess the expression of SOD and MDA and observe the change of kidney by microscope. To investigate the mechanism of action about remifentanil's anti-RIRI.Methods Seventy-two Wistar rats were randomly divided into 4 groups:sham operation group(S group), ischemia reperfusion group (IR group), remifentanil of low dose(L group), remifentanil of high dose (H group).Each group cut the rignt renal to avoid it's substitution action.In S group, infuse physiological solt solution for 30min.In IR group,30min's infusion of physiological solt solution was administrated before ischemia. In Lgroup,30min's infusion of remifentanil of 0.2μg·kg-1·min-1 was administrated before ischemia while that was 1μg·kg-1·min-1 in H group. Kill the rats at 0.5h,2h and 4h.Expression of SOD and MDA was assessed.Results The expression of SOD were significantly lower in IR,L,H than S group,while the MDA expression were significantly higher than S group.The difference between groups has statistical significance(P<0.01). The expression of SOD were significantly higher in L and H than IR group(P<0.01). The expression of MDA were significantly lower in L and H than IR group(P<0.01).H group has statistical significance on the expression of SOD(P<0.01).Conclusion Remifentanil preconditioning can relieve the renal oxidative damage by regulating SOD and MDA expression and protect renal from ischemia reperfusion damage.The protective effect of H group is more than L group.
